Transaction cc54d110551f84707619df32c3120fdcd2946eefd99eed59790aab1d5cc32655
1 Input
2 Outputs
- cc54d110551f84707619df32c3120fdcd2946eefd99eed59790aab1d5cc32655:0
- cc54d110551f84707619df32c3120fdcd2946eefd99eed59790aab1d5cc32655:1
value 2378521
address 1LWG6ZStvVnWrhTTE1dcGdcmMUc6p29oM2
value 620000
address 32o8iPzbdaotd1f6r5PBABu54eBEKfvFNU